Where did Jules go when she was kid?

She was admitted to a psychiatric hospital as a child. When Jules was 11, her mom took her on a “road trip” to see a psychiatrist. At the end of the session, she was told that she was being given a tour of a psychiatric hospital.

What did Jules inject herself with in the first episode?

Jules is trans (something indicated to the audience not via monologue but through a quick shot of her injecting hormones into her thigh), and it’s welcome that Euphoria doesn’t tie Jules’s self-destructive streak to her transness but, instead, to her devastation in the wake of her parents’ divorce.

What happens to Jules Euphoria?

At the end of season 1, Rue and Jules ended up separated because Jules wanted to run away and Rue decided not to go. There was a very dramatic “I can’t get on the train” scene that was, to put it lightly, heartbreaking.
